Footnote: The Battalion was raised in Edmonton, Alberta under the authority of G. O. 86, July 1, 1915. The mobilization headquarters was also at Edmonton. The Battalion sailed June 4, 1915 with a strength of 36 officers and 996 other ranks under the command of Lieutenant Colonel W. A. Griesbach. The Battalion served in France
